Bio
David Burman was blessed to be born into a Christian family. At age eight he was led by his mother to pray for salvation. Throughout his childhood he attended services at a small Baptist church with his family.
After graduating from high school and working a year in a factory, David attended Practical Bible Training School (PBTS), now Davis College in Johnson City, New York. While there, he learned that there are faithful Christians besides Baptists. It was during this time that he was first exposed to the “doctrines of grace”.
After attending PBTS he joined the First Baptist Church in Afton, NY and for the next 20 years served on several committees, taught Sunday School, and worked in the library.
In May of 1998 David and his family moved to Greenville, and he started work at Bob Jones University in the Information Technology department and remains there today.
David and Audrey have two married children and five grandchildren.
After attending several other churches in Greenville, David and Audrey finally visited Second Presbyterian in 2014 and joined the church in 2016. David is pleased to be part of this ministry, and he looks forward to serving the Lord as a deacon, desiring to be a blessing to others.
